The Accufab and Dragon being of higher quality is debatable. if anything, I'd say they were "prettier" to look at since they're cut from a single piece of billet, but that's as far as I'd take it. The usage of Billet aluminum gets beaten to death once too often. Billet is used when strength issues need to be addressed and weight issues are still a concern. Now, every time someone sells something that's been made out of billet aluminum, it’s automatically labeled as a superior product. Billet throttle-body, cast throttle body…ones going to perform as well as another. You pay for the name and a prettier package with the Accufab, but in the end, it's still not moving any more air, or proving any more durable than the BBK.
